Smeg high-capacity laboratory glassware washers are designed for medium- and large-scale laboratories that need to process substantial volumes of reusable glassware, instruments and laboratory accessories every day.
The range includes the GW6010, GW7010, GW7015 and GW6290 models. These professional machines combine large chamber capacities, antibacterial thermal disinfection, forced hot-air drying, flexible loading configurations and advanced cycle traceability.
Suitable for pharmaceutical, research, analytical, industrial, quality-control and petrochemical laboratories, the high-capacity range enables laboratories to process a wide variety of items, including bottles, flasks, beakers, graduated cylinders, pipettes, vials, test tubes and other reusable laboratory equipment.

GW7015
Large-Capacity Glassware Washer with Dual Washing Pumps
The GW7015 is designed for laboratories with higher throughput requirements and larger or more demanding loads. With a 354-litre chamber, wider loading area and dual independent washing pumps, it provides increased washing pressure and improved performance for complex loads.
The model features a sliding-door configuration and is available in single-door or double-door pass-through versions.
Technical Specifications

Main Features
- Large 354-litre chamber for high-volume laboratory workloads.
- Two independent washing pumps for increased water pressure and enhanced washing performance.
- Dual-motor forced hot-air drying system.
- Drying-air filter with 98% DOP efficiency.
- Ready for optional H14 absolute HEPA filtration.
- Adjustable washing levels and modular loading arrangements.
- Suitable for loading with universal trolleys, dedicated injection racks and specialised glassware accessories.
- Thermal disinfection up to 95°C.
- Pre-heating tank configuration available to reduce cycle times by preparing incoming water before the wash process.
- Standard liquid-detergent and neutraliser dosing pumps.
- Additional peristaltic dosing-pump options for more complex washing chemistries.
- Cold, hot and demineralised-water connections.
- Internal memory for recording programme data, alarms and cycle parameters.
- Colour TFT touch-screen interface with USB connectivity.
- Supplied software for monitoring, programme customisation and documentation management.
- Optional Ethernet connection, integrated printer, LED chamber lighting and spray-arm rotation control.
- Optional conductivity sensor for monitoring washing quality.
- Electronic door-locking system.

Flexible Loading Systems and Accessories
Smeg high-capacity glassware washers can be configured with a broad selection of loading trolleys, injection racks and dedicated accessories. This enables each machine to be tailored to the laboratory’s specific glassware types, load volumes and workflow requirements.
Available loading solutions include:
- Universal loading trolleys
- Loading and unloading trolleys
- Spray-washing racks
- Injection-washing racks for narrow-neck bottles and flasks
- Inserts for small laboratory glassware
- Racks for vials and test tubes
- Supports for graduated cylinders
- Pipette washing and rinsing systems
- Solutions for large bottles, flasks and volumetric glassware
Depending on the selected configuration, the machines can accommodate up to five or six adjustable washing levels, supporting efficient processing of mixed and high-volume laboratory loads.
